Abstract

We explored prognostic roles of circulating microRNAs (miRs) in multiple myeloma (MM) treated with autologous stem cell transplantation (ASCT) following induction chemotherapy. In part I of the study (n=40), we identified a decreasing dynamics of circulating miR-193a-5p expression from diagnosis to pre-ASCT. In patients who experienced early relapse within one year post ASCT (n=9) these patterns were distinctive compared to those without early relapse in a 1:2 matched cohort (n=18). In part II (n=90), multivariate analyses showed that the International Staging System score and miR-193a-5p expression before ASCT were independent prognostic factors. Conclusively, expression of circulating miR-193a-5p before ASCT could be a prognostic biomarker for transplant-eligible MM.
